site stats

Smaller batch size is better

WebbIt does not affect accuracy, but it affects the training speed and memory usage. Most common batch sizes are 16,32,64,128,512…etc, but it doesn't necessarily have to be a power of two. Avoid choosing a batch size too high or you'll get a "resource exhausted" error, which is caused by running out of memory. Webb29 okt. 2016 · It'd be better for the nodes then allowing the buffer to balloon up uncontrollably. Not great for usability, obviously, but better than nothing ... where most are tiny, but there are a few big ones peppered in to make my life fun. Have to run a small batch size -- like egyptianbman, constantly trying again with smaller and ...

Ritesh Goel - Founder & C.E.O. - HR Reflections - Executive Search …

Webb16 feb. 2016 · More on batch size... Not considering hardware, "pure SGD" with the optimal batch size of 1 leads to the fastest training; batch sizes greater than 1 only slow down training. However, considering today's parallel hardware, larger batch sizes train faster with regard to actual clock time and that is why it is better to have batch sizes like 256 say. WebbBarks Tech. Dec 2024 - Present4 years 5 months. - Barks Headphones are classroom headphones built better that last. - Headphones designed specifically for students of all ages, K-12 & beyond ... city tech counseling https://zigglezag.com

python - What is batch size in neural network? - Cross Validated

Webb4 okt. 2024 · Optimal batch sizing is an outgrowth of queuing theory. The reason you reduce batch sizes is to reduce variability. In agile contexts, SAFe explains the benefit of smaller batch sizes this way: The reduced variability results from the smaller number of items in the batch. Since each item has some variability, the accumulation of a large … Webb25 maj 2024 · This is because the learning rate and batch size are closely linked — small batch sizes perform best with smaller learning rates, while large batch sizes do best on … Webb7 juli 2024 · Total training samples=5000. Batch Size=32. Epochs=100. One epoch is been all of your data goes through the forward and backward like all of your 5000 samples. Then…. 32 samples will be taken at a time to train the network. To go through all 5000 samples it takes 157 (5000/32)iterations for one epoch. This process continues 100 … citytech comd courese

Small Batch Production: Pros, Cons, & Everything You Need to Know

Category:GitHub - google-research/simclr: SimCLRv2 - Big Self-Supervised …

Tags:Smaller batch size is better

Smaller batch size is better

How big should batch size and number of epochs be when fitting a mo…

Webb19 mars 2012 · A small batch size lends itself well to quicker problem detection and resolution (the field of focus in addressing the problem can be contained to the footprint of that small batch and the work that is still fresh in everyone’s mind). Reduces product risk – This builds on the idea of faster feedback. WebbFully-connected layers, also known as linear layers, connect every input neuron to every output neuron and are commonly used in neural networks. Figure 1. Example of a small fully-connected layer with four input and eight output neurons. Three parameters define a fully-connected layer: batch size, number of inputs, and number of outputs.

Smaller batch size is better

Did you know?

Webb5 feb. 2024 · If inference speed is extremely important for your use case, ... Overall, we find that choosing an appropriate format has a significant impact for smaller batch sizes, but that impact narrows down as batches get larger, with batches of 64 samples the 3 setups are within ~10% of each other. Webb13 okt. 2024 · DistilBERT's best of 20 runs was 62.5% accuracy. Both of these RTE scores are slightly better than the reported scores of 69.3% and 59.9%. I guess the hyperparameter search was worth it after all! Batch size and Learning Rate. For each model, we tested out 20 different (batch_size, learning_rate) combinations.

WebbWith smaller batch sizes a small business can improve their customer service through flexibility and reduce their costs by managing fewer inventories. Andrew Goldman is an Isenberg School of Management MBA student at the University of Massachusetts Amherst. He has extensive experience working with small businesses on a consulting basis. WebbBatch size is an important factor in production planning and inventory management, as it can impact production costs, lead times, ... Conversely, smaller batch sizes may reduce inventory costs but could increase per-unit production costs due to more frequent machine setups and less efficient use of resources.

Webb2 juni 2024 · While transactional costs decrease with bigger batch sizes, the maintenance costs increase exponentially. When software is not maintained often with small steps, the degree of the disorder increases because many dependencies get new updates and changes. After a while, maintenance efforts start becoming bigger. Webbthe prior, where nis greater than the desired batch size, k. We then perform Core-set selection on the large batch of size nto create a batch of size k. By applying Core-set sampling on the randomly over-sampled prior, we obtain a small sparse batch that approximates the shape of the hy-percube. The smaller batch is what’s actually used to …

Webb8 jan. 2024 · Notice that Small Batch training has generally better training performance. Even in networks where we have lower training accuracy for SB training, we notice a …

WebbIntroducing batch size. Put simply, the batch size is the number of samples that will be passed through to the network at one time. Note that a batch is also commonly referred to as a mini-batch. The batch size is the number of samples that are passed to the network at once. Now, recall that an epoch is one single pass over the entire training ... city tech course listWebb1 dec. 2024 · On one hand, a small batch size can converge faster than a large batch, but a large batch can reach optimum minima that a small batch size cannot reach. Also, a small batch size can have a significant regularization effect because of its high variance [9], but it will require a small learning rate to prevent it from overshooting the minima [10 ... city tech coursesWebb4 nov. 2024 · Because you’re producing fewer components and parts, small batches are cheaper to manufacture. On top of that, they take up less storage space. That means … double sided movie moneyWebb4 nov. 2024 · Because you’re producing fewer components and parts, small batches are cheaper to manufacture. On top of that, they take up less storage space. That means you don’t need huge warehouses to store your product because there just isn’t as much of it. Increased Efficiency Finally, our last point is that small batch production is a huge time … citytech cstWebbThat would be the equivalent a smaller batch size. Now if you take 100 samples from a distribution, the mean will likely be closer to the real mean. The is the equivalent of a larger batch size. This is only a weak analogy to the update, it’s meant more as a visualization of the noise of a smaller batch size. city tech construction managementdouble sided murphy doorWebb29 sep. 2016 · While the minimum font size for body text has been acknowledged as 16px for a while, I believe a better starting point would be 20px on small desktop displays and greater. city tech covid testing